Theatre by the Lake shows for children and their families

Theatre by the Lake in Keswick has a spring programme lined up for children and their families.

Around the World in 80 Days is brought to the stage in a new production March 31 to April 29.

The Lost Spells—A New Musical (May 24–June 3) is adapted from the book by Robert Macfarlane and Jackie Morris, with music and dancing live on stage.

Kitchen Zoo presents Hey Diddle Diddle April 11–12, where nursery rhyme characters come to party, perform and have fun! And Pirate Bonnie takes to the stage April 14, courtesy of Fidget Theatre.

For teens, Pentabus Theatre returns May 9–11 with One of them Ones, a new play about two siblings living in an isolated rural community trying to get their heads around gender identity. Shewolves by Sarah Middleton, May 13, is a coming-of-age comedy for teenagers.

Looking ahead to Christmas, Theatre by the Lake presents the world première of A Little Princess, adapted for the stage by Amanda Dalton from the novel by Frances Hodgson Burnett.
